An IT Technical Support Analyst I position is available with the City of Fort Worth IT Solutionsโ€™ Desktop Services Division. This position provides level 2 technical support for users to resolve various issues involving hardware, software, and peripherals. Maintains computing infrastructure including imaging, configuring systems, installing and troubleshooting hardware and software. Provide customer service, identify problems and provide solutions ensuring prompt and permanent resolution.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• High school diploma/GED.
  • One (1) year of responsible computer related experience.
  • Minimum of one (1) certification specific to the Technical Support division.
  • Valid Driverโ€™s License.
  • Candidate selected for hire must pass a CJIS background check (see below for details).

Preferred Qualifications:

  • One (1) or more of the following certifications: MCP, MCSE, CompTIA Network+, CompTIA Security+, ITIL Foundations certification, Google IT Support Certification, HDI Desktop Support Technician (DST)
  • Four (4) years of recent experience supporting Windows, iPad/iPhone, Android and Mac OS. 2 Years of experience with direct involvement in hardware break-fix processes for desktops, laptops, and mobile devices
  • Knowledge of ITIL processes and ticketing systems for documenting and completing work
  • Knowledge of Windows installation/support/troubleshooting tools and working with hardware and software vendors
  • Knowledge of TCP/IP, DNS, and client-side connectivity troubleshooting
  • Some college work preferred

The IT Technical Support Analyst Iโ€™s job responsibilities include:

  • Provide support and management of client devices and computer endpoints.
  • Provide expert level support of Windows Operating Systems (10 and higher), iPad/iPhone, and Android client devices.
  • Office 2016, 2019, O365 support.
  • Install and set up new computer workstations; responds to requests for equipment.
  • Ability to troubleshoot and resolve complex software and hardware issues on endpoints and other technology equipment.
  • Perform break-fix repairs on desktops, laptops, mobile devices and other technological equipment.
  • Provide technical support through in-person and remote support utilizing phone, email and remote tools.
  • Develop recommendations for procedures to prevent problems.
  • Evaluating and resolving complex problems that arise.
  • Other related duties as required.

Criminal Justice Information Systems (CJIS) Background Check
